This 4-in-1 Natural Gas Leak and Carbon Monoxide Detector by NICGOL offers a versatile safety solution by combining detection of natural gas, propane, carbon monoxide, temperature, and humidity in one compact device. Its catalytic sensor and dual-sensor technology provide sensitive and reliable monitoring of dangerous gases, with audible and visual alarms that activate quickly when hazardous levels are detected. The alarm is loud enough (≥85dB) and includes flashing lights to ensure you notice the warning promptly, which is crucial for protecting families in homes and mobile spaces like RVs.
Powered by a standard 110V-220V AC plug, it avoids the hassle of batteries and provides continuous operation with low power consumption, making it an energy-efficient choice. The bright LCD screen offers real-time readings of gas concentration, temperature, and humidity, which can be helpful in understanding your environment beyond just gas detection. Its compact size allows easy placement in various settings without taking up much space.
Installation requires a brief calibration period to ensure accurate measurements, and there is a manual test button for peace of mind to confirm the alarm functions correctly. This model is suitable for homeowners or RV users seeking multi-threat detection with simple plug-in setup. Note that relying solely on AC power means it may not function during power outages unless additional backup power is used. Buyers should verify compliance with local safety standards if required. This detector provides a comprehensive, user-friendly way to monitor propane, natural gas, carbon monoxide, and environmental conditions, making it a strong option for general home and RV safety where power outlet access is available.
The Kidde Carbon Monoxide Detector is a versatile device designed to detect carbon monoxide, propane, natural gas, methane, and explosive gases, making it a great fit for households that rely on gas appliances. One of its key strengths is the easy plug-in installation, which allows users to set it up without professional help. The included 9-volt battery backup ensures that the detector remains operational during power outages, providing peace of mind. The digital LED display is user-friendly, clearly indicating gas levels or signaling when gas is detected, while the 85-decibel alarm is loud enough to alert you to potential dangers.
Another notable feature is the Peak Level Memory, which helps track when gas was last detected, enabling efficient monitoring over time. Additionally, the Test-Hush Button simplifies the process of testing the detector or silencing false alarms, a handy feature for those who may be sensitive to repetitive sounds.
There are some drawbacks to consider. The unit relies on a wall outlet for power, which might limit placement options compared to battery-operated models. Users in very humid environments may also want to ensure the device operates well within the 5% to 95% relative humidity range, as this could impact its performance. While the warranty of 5 years provides reassurance, the effective lifespan of 7 years suggests users should be mindful of when to replace it to ensure continued safety.
The Klein Tools ET120 Gas Leak Detector is designed for those needing a reliable and versatile propane gas detector. It has a wide detection range from 50 to 10,000 ppm, making it suitable for various monitoring needs. You can adjust the sensitivity to high or low settings, allowing for more precise gas detection.
The detector features both visual and audible alerts, with five red LEDs and an 85dB alarm that intensify as gas concentration increases, ensuring you won't miss any warnings. The flexible 18-inch gooseneck is a standout feature, allowing you to reach difficult spots easily. It’s user-friendly with automatic zero-point calibration at power-up, although the flashing lights during calibration might be slightly distracting for some.
The over-molded body ensures a comfortable grip and durability, making prolonged use manageable. Battery life is extended with the auto power-off feature, although it requires four AAA batteries, which are included. One notable drawback is that it might not be as effective in extremely humid conditions, given its 85 percent operating humidity limit. Suitable for both professional and home use, the Klein Tools ET120 offers a balance of functionality, ease of use, and reliability.
